New minor risk - Share price stability The company's share price has been volatile over the past 3 months. It is more volatile than 75% of Brazilian stocks, typically moving 6.5% a week. This is considered a minor risk. Share price volatility indicates the stock is highly sensitive to market conditions or economic conditions rather than being sensitive to its own business performance, which may also be inconsistent. It also increases the risk of potential losses in the short term as the stock tends to have larger drops in price more frequently than other stocks.
